如何将irdadump包含在Yocto(Poky)irda-utils 0.9.18包中

时间:2017-04-27 00:00:59

标签: yocto bitbake openembedded

请原谅我缺乏知识和不正确使用术语。一世 我希望在Yocto的构建图像中包含irdadump。

我修改了 /poky/meta/recipes-connectivity/irda-utils/irda-utils_0.9.18.bb文件到 在要构建的目标列表中包含irdadump。

INITSCRIPT_NAME = "irattach"
INITSCRIPT_PARAMS = "defaults 20"

TARGETS ??= "irattach irdaping irdadump"
do_compile () {
         for t in ${TARGETS}; do
                 oe_runmake -C $t
         done
}

然而,bitbake进程失败,归结为依赖性 idradump需要pkg-config和glib 2.0。

我在网上进行了快速搜索,发现有一个单独的.bb irdadump的文件: http://cgit.openembedded.org/openembedded/plain/recipes/irda-utils/

我试图复制这个,但仍面临编译问题。

任何人都可以帮我把irdadump包括在内 irda-utils包?

谢谢

1 个答案:

答案 0 :(得分:4)

要将irda-utils添加到构建映像中,只需在conf / local.conf文件中添加IMAGE_INSTALL_append。下次运行Bitbake时,它将在构建映像中包含irda-utlis包。

IMAGE_INSTALL_append = " irda-utils"